ABOUT RICHARD ATKINS KC

Richard is the Head of St Philips Chambers. He was the Chair of the Bar in 2019, Leader of the Midland Circuit 20••••17, and is a Bencher of Gray\'s Inn. He is a past head of the St Philips Chambers Regulatory Group and specialises in Regulatory and serious criminal matters. Described in the Legal 500 as \"The dedicated Richard Atkins QC is a powerful and persuasive advocate who attracts praise for his ability to control the Courtroom and proceedings.\" Placed in Band 1 of the Chambers and Partners Directory which states \"Has a substantial practice in serious crime and regulatory law.\" He has extensive experience in homicide cases; health and safety fatal accident cases (including corporate manslaughter) and inquests; trading standards & consumer law cases (he prosecuted Tesco in 2013 for their mis-selling of strawberries & prosecuted the leading Consumer Protection from Unfair Trading Regulations case \"R v X Ltd\" in the Court of Appeal. His reputation is as an approachable, engaging and entertaining advocate. He is well known for his ability to assimilate a large amount of facts and to put the matters across to the jury in an easily digestible manner. He defends and prosecutes. Richard regularly lectures to defence solicitors, the CPS and Police. He was a panel member of the 2014 IOSH National Safety Symposium fatal accidents debate. Richard sits as a Crown Court Recorder and is a part-time Judge of the Restricted Patients Panel of the First-tier Tribunal (Health Education and Social Care Chamber)(Mental Health). He is a Legal Chairman of the Financial Reporting Council\'s Disciplinary Tribunals. Richard is a qualified Advocacy Trainer. Richard was Chairman of the Governors of the Coventry School Foundation (King Henry and Bablake Schools). He is regularly booked for after-dinner speaking engagements.
